Delaying Cataract Surgery - Any associated dangers?
Compared to Europe they are on the lower end of the scale despite top equipment and professional staff on the entire front. AMD can, if diagnosed earlier enough, be treated/reversed with monthly, six-weekly and ultimately bi-monthly treatments of (expensive) medication which must be administered in a sterile operating theatre at the hospital. Alternatively, a skilled expert, can try to apply sclerotherapy of capillary blood vessels in the back of the retina. This is done with a low energy laser procedure.
